Cleaning Manager cover letter example

Jackson Miller

Indianapolis, Indiana

+1-(234)-555-1234

help@enhancv.com


Dear Hiring Manager,

I've had the opportunity to follow the outstanding growth and impact your organization delivers within the industry. The strategic vision aligns with my career path, particularly where operational leadership plays a critical role in scaling services.

While serving as the Regional Operations Supervisor at CleanPro Services, I undertook a significant initiative to revamp our scheduling system. This challenge was aimed at enhancing efficiency and reducing costs in managing over a hundred employees across multiple sites. Through a series of strategic shifts and the introduction of innovative project management tools, we achieved a 15% reduction in labor expenses. This structural adjustment did not affect service quality, as evidenced by a direct improvement in customer satisfaction ratings by 20%, a testament to the seamless blend of cost-saving and quality assurance techniques I prioritize.

I am eager to bring this same expertise to your esteemed team, confident that my proactive approach and dedication to operational excellence can contribute to your company's success. I welcome the opportunity to discuss how my background, skills, and accomplishments will align with the goals of your organization.

Sincerely, Jackson Miller, Experienced Manager
What makes this cover letter good:


  • Highlighting industry-relevant experience: The cover letter showcases the candidate's relevant experience by mentioning a previous role (Regional Operations Supervisor) and detailing a specific successful initiative.
  • Quantifiable achievements: It includes specific metrics, such as a 15% reduction in labor expenses and a 20% increase in customer satisfaction ratings, demonstrating the candidate's ability to deliver measurable results.
  • Alignment with the company's strategic vision: The applicant mentions their understanding of the company's strategic vision and how their career path complements the operational leadership role.
  • Soft skills and expertise: The cover letter emphasizes the candidate's proactive approach and dedication to operational excellence, indicating their soft skills and managerial expertise.

The top sections on a cleaning manager cover letter

  • Header with Contact Information: Include your name, address, phone number, and email address so the recruiter can easily get in touch with you, showing professionalism and attention to detail, which are critical for a cleaning manager.
  • Introduction: Start with a strong opening that showcases your experience in the cleaning industry and your understanding of effective team leadership, as these are two key aspects of a cleaning manager's role.
  • Professional Experience and Achievements: Highlight your previous positions, duties, and accomplishments that are directly relevant to managing a cleaning team, such as improving efficiency, budget management, and staff training.
  • Cleaning Methodology and Standards: Discuss your commitment to high cleaning standards and your knowledge of various cleaning techniques and health/safety regulations to demonstrate your qualification for overseeing cleaning operations.
  • Closing and Call to Action: Finish with a confident statement expressing your enthusiasm for the position and request an opportunity for an interview, emphasizing your proactive and results-driven approach as a cleaning manager.
top sections icon

Key qualities recruiters search for in a candidate’s cover letter

  • Proven leadership and team management skills: Ability to motivate and guide a diverse cleaning team to ensure efficient and high-quality cleaning services.
  • Experience in developing and implementing cleaning protocols: Knowledgeable in setting up systems and standards to maintain cleanliness and hygiene in various environments.
  • Proficiency in budget management: Aptitude for managing financial aspects, such as supply inventory, equipment maintenance, and labor costs, to keep operations cost-effective.
  • In-depth knowledge of health and safety regulations: Understanding of OSHA standards and the importance of maintaining a safe working environment for staff and clients.
  • Strong communication and client relations abilities: Capable of effectively interacting with clients to understand their needs and ensuring customer satisfaction with cleaning services provided.
  • Flexibility and problem-solving skills: Adaptability to handle unexpected situations or emergencies, as well as the capacity to find solutions to issues that arise within the scope of cleaning management.

What greeting should you use in your cleaning manager cover letter salutation

A simple "Hello" or "Hey" just won't work.

With your cleaning manager cover letter salutation, you set the tone of the whole communication.

You should thus address the hiring managers by using their first (or last name) in your greeting.

But how do you find out who's recruiting for the role?

The easiest way is to look up the role on LinkedIn or the corporate website.

Alternatively, you could also contact the organization via social media or email, for more information.

Unable to still obtain the recruiter's name?

Don't go down the "To whom it may concern path". Instead, start your cover letter with a "Dear HR team".

What to write on your cleaning manager cover letter, when you have zero experience

The best advice for candidates, writing their cleaning manager cover letters with no experience, is this - be honest.

If you have no past professional roles in your portfolio, focus recruiters' attention on your strengths - like your unique, transferrable skill set (gained as a result of your whole life), backed up by one key achievement.

Or, maybe you dream big and have huge motivation to join the company. Use your cleaning manager cover letter to describe your career ambition - that one that keeps you up at night, dreaming about your future.

Finally, always ensure you've answered why employers should hire precisely you and how your skills would benefit their organization.
